    • Place of origin
      South Africa. Garden origin. UK. Bob Brown, Cotswold Garden Flowers.
    • Shades of pink
      All shades of pink through to Carmine (red)
      Coral coloured
    • Spikes
      Branched spikes of funnel-shaped flowers to 6cm (2½in) across
    • Border
      Suits a mixed or herbaceous border
    • Cottage garden
    • Town garden
    • Fully hardy
    • Height
      80cm (32in)
    • Spread
      40cm (16in)
    • Bulb/Corm or rhizomatous perennial
      Robust, clump-forming, cormous perennial with erect, linear leaves
    • Hardy - very cold winter
      Hardy in all of UK and northern Europe. Plant can possibly withstand temperatures down to -20°C (-4°F)
